WHAT IS IMMUNOTHERAPY?
KEYTRUDA is known as an immune therapy (or immunotherapy) because it works with your immune system to help find and treat cancer cells. KEYTRUDA helps your immune system do what it is designed to do — help your own body treat cancer.
Your immune system
Your body defends itself against disease with a very complex combination of organs, cells and substances that together form the immune system. This system identifies things in your body that could harm you, and works to remove them. These harmful substances may have entered your body from outside, e.g. bacteria; or may have developed within your body, e.g. cancer cells.
The immune system’s ability to find and remove abnormal cells usually stops cancers from developing, however some cancer cells find ways to stop the immune system from destroying them, and some cancer cells can change over time and then hide from the immune system.
Immunotherapy
Over time, medicines have been developed that can help your immune system fight cancer. They can do this by:
- stimulating your immune system to work harder, or smarter
- removing barriers to the immune system attacking the cancer.
KEYTRUDA is an immunotherapy. It helps your own immune system fight your cancer.
KEYTRUDA is not chemotherapy. Chemotherapy involves the use of medicines to kill or slow the growth of cancer cells.
